Fine Porcelain Specialty Auction

Ahlers & Ogletree is pleased to present 439 lots of fine porcelain including more than 500 Boehm and Doughty birds, many in their original wood boxes, as well as sets of fine china, objets d'art, and important military & animal figurines from America, England, and Europe.
